Output d4d77b71f5eeca958f3a3349aaf792f1bd439d31c48c3e7c4e1fcba839ef2cee:1

value
258308
script pubkey
OP_0 OP_PUSHBYTES_20 17e0e2a654694972aa90bcfe78e8c59063f6ae9d
address
bc1qzlsw9fj5d9yh925shnl836x9jp3ldt5ansugpj
transaction
d4d77b71f5eeca958f3a3349aaf792f1bd439d31c48c3e7c4e1fcba839ef2cee
confirmations
349799
spent
true